Donald Stephan Vandertill
MilitaryAssigned to 863BS, 493BG, 8AF USAAF. Shot down on 21st mission over Sudwigshaven on 13-Sep-44. Prisoner of War (POW) until May 1945. Plane was B-17 43-38225.
Awards: AM (2OLC), POW, GC, EAME (4BS), American Campaign, WWII Victory.
